Remianen Posted August 7, 2006 Share Posted August 7, 2006 [QUOTE=vocalorigami]or add a new promotion as my development camp without having to ask to be my dev camp.[/QUOTE] Dunno if you know this or not but you can do this already. Kinda. Import the promotion and, after an owner takes it over, change that owner's personality to 'Very nice'. Assuming your promotion is bigger, 99% of the time, your parent company request will be accepted. Then, if you want, change the owner's personality back after the deal is done.
